@@ -0,0 +1,90 @@
|
||||
use memmap;
|
||||
use std::fmt;
|
||||
|
||||
const PAGE_SIZE: u32 = 65536;
|
||||
const MAX_PAGES: u32 = 65536;
|
||||
|
||||
/// A linear memory instance.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// This linear memory has a stable base address and at the same time allows
|
||||
/// for dynamical growing.
|
||||
pub struct LinearMemory {
|
||||
mmap: memmap::MmapMut,
|
||||
current: u32,
|
||||
maximum: u32,
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
impl LinearMemory {
|
||||
/// Create a new linear memory instance with specified initial and maximum number of pages.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// `maximum` cannot be set to more than `65536` pages. If `maximum` is `None` then it
|
||||
/// will be treated as `65336`.
|
||||
pub fn new(initial: u32, maximum: Option<u32>) -> Self {
|
||||
let maximum = maximum.unwrap_or(MAX_PAGES);
|
||||
|
||||
assert!(initial <= MAX_PAGES);
|
||||
assert!(maximum <= MAX_PAGES);
|
||||
|
||||
let len = maximum.saturating_mul(MAX_PAGES);
|
||||
let mmap = memmap::MmapMut::map_anon(len as usize).unwrap();
|
||||
Self {
|
||||
mmap,
|
||||
current: initial,
|
||||
maximum,
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Returns an base address of this linear memory.
|
||||
pub fn base_addr(&mut self) -> *mut u8 {
|
||||
self.mmap.as_mut_ptr()
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Returns a number of allocated wasm pages.
|
||||
pub fn current_size(&self) -> u32 {
|
||||
self.current
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Grow memory by the specified amount of pages.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// Returns `None` if memory can't be grown by the specified amount
|
||||
/// of pages.
|
||||
pub fn grow(&mut self, add_pages: u32) -> Option<u32> {
|
||||
let new_pages = match self.current.checked_add(add_pages) {
|
||||
Some(new_pages) => new_pages,
|
||||
None => return None,
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
let prev_pages = self.current;
|
||||
self.current = new_pages;
|
||||
|
||||
// Ensure that newly allocated area is zeroed.
|
||||
let new_start_offset = (prev_pages * PAGE_SIZE) as usize;
|
||||
let new_end_offset = (new_pages * PAGE_SIZE) as usize;
|
||||
for i in new_start_offset..new_end_offset - 1 {
|
||||
self.mmap[i] = 0;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
Some(prev_pages)
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
impl fmt::Debug for LinearMemory {
|
||||
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
|
||||
f.debug_struct("LinearMemory")
|
||||
.field("current", &self.current)
|
||||
.field("maximum", &self.maximum)
|
||||
.finish()
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
impl AsRef<[u8]> for LinearMemory {
|
||||
fn as_ref(&self) -> &[u8] {
|
||||
&self.mmap
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
impl AsMut<[u8]> for LinearMemory {
|
||||
fn as_mut(&mut self) -> &mut [u8] {
|
||||
&mut self.mmap
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
